Just watched the full 90 minutes of the Boro game, and saw a lot of positives. Granted, I am probably the opposite of a football scout, but I love what I see from Nemeth. I think a lot of strikers would love for someone to say about them, "all he does is score goals" they would say great, thats my job,  and I must be doing it well enough for them to say thats all i do, but he is always getting involved and linking attacking from wide, getting in good positions AS WELL AS finishing. Should have had 2 in this one, but everybody misses a chance here and there. I know its to early but . . he NEEDS to play in the FA Cup tie, can't wait to see more from this kid.  Also, I love this kid because he gets the BIGGEST SMile on his face every time he scores.  Its like he got everything he could have asked for and more on Christmas everytime.  After his first goal in his first game he looked back at Gary and gave him a thumbs up and a big smile.

Insua started slow, and had the ball taken off him rather easily a couple times in the begining, but he is constantly bombing forward playing nice one-twos, has a good left foot.  Could still use some shoring up of his defensive skills and final attacking move decision making ability. Can see why he is not yet ready for Prime Time, but can also see that he is a keeper (and no not a goalkeeper)

Plessis does well in controlling the midfield, but too many stray passes for me, certainly a LOT of upside though.

Huth and San Jose, both big and solid at the back, I'd give the edge to Huth as an all around player

Darby is quality, but for me, I would think he would need 18 months or so of first team action elseswhere before giving him a legit shot and making the position his own. 

Puterill lots of passion for the club, and has skill with BOTH feet ( a real problem for a lot of the team) but I would probably bet against him making it into the first team  (I am guessing that is probably the case for most of the players if you play odds maker but the pay is only 2:1 on any player)

Crowther - new right winger from stockport county. got a rare chance because he normally sits so El Zhar or Puterill can play.  Don't really rate the players ahead of him so needless to say I don't have high hopes for Ryan.  But her did TRY very hard to impress, he just didn't.  I think there was some double swoop package deal when we got him or something where we also brought in an U16 from Stockport as well, but I could be confusing him with somebody else

Jordy Brouwer - needs to go.  He just doesnt cut it as a striker IMO. He is like a taller lankier Voronin, but with the worst finishing of any person claiming to be a striker.  TO be fair, in the last couple of games he has had some nice touches that linked the play up. But IMO, he is just taking away chances for Lindfield, Pacheco, Bruna, Pourie, and Eccelston. Sounds a bit harsh, but I think it is true.

David Martin - Could use 18-24 months on loan as a consistent starter before he can replace Itandje.

Leto - I think he could benefit from spending the 2nd half of the season trying to keep a Scottish side up like Hammill did last year. It would really toughen him up and give him some consistent playing time

El Zhar - who either traveled to France or his hurt (can't remember which) is already 21 and been at the club for over a year, Pennant is hurt, and he still can't get a game. I have to question whether or not he has plateaued or not.  Sadly, would probably also have to say that the odds are against him.
